Output 0dd66fc03cf8ed5a736930c0d3214fc7f1c06b986df2724d311db8a7424f05df:187

value
34462
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5f739c4190bdd5f0c6b7027fd4d826b1fa14404c OP_EQUALVERIFY OP_CHECKSIG
address
19hhgyUBxuLyTE7W12b8wAYb7Q9CKT1cxD
transaction
0dd66fc03cf8ed5a736930c0d3214fc7f1c06b986df2724d311db8a7424f05df
confirmations
484340
spent
true